El Rancho is warm year‑round; visit during the dry season (Nov-Apr) for sun and easier travel. The rainy months are humid and stormy but visually lush.
Best Time to Visit El Rancho #
El Rancho's climate is classified as Tropical Monsoon - Tropical Monsoon climate with consistently warm temperatures year-round. Temperatures range from 20°C to 34°C. Abundant rainfall (1868 mm/year), wettest in October.

How to Get to El Rancho
El Rancho in Cortés is reached most easily via San Pedro Sula (SAP), the regional air and road hub. Expect onward travel by bus, colectivo or taxi from the city to reach smaller towns and villages.
Ramón Villeda Morales International Airport, San Pedro Sula (SAP): San Pedro Sula is the closest major airport for northern Cortés Department. From SAP take a taxi or shuttle into the city (20-30 minutes, ~US$15-US$25) then continue by bus or local taxi to smaller towns.
Toncontín International Airport, Tegucigalpa (TGU): Tegucigalpa is an option for some inland routes; from the city center you will need to take intercity bus services northward - expect several hours of road travel to reach coastal or departmental towns.
Train: Honduras does not offer intercity passenger train services; trains are not a travel option.
Bus: Intercity buses and private coach lines connect San Pedro Sula to towns across Cortés Department. For shorter connections within the department, local bus networks and colectivos operate frequently; fares are generally inexpensive (a few dollars) and journey times vary by route and traffic.
